Common Web Design Mistakes & How to Avoid Them
Many budding web creators frequently fall into several frequent errors that can damage the overall impression. Avoiding these problems is crucial for a effective online platform . Here’s a quick look at a few of the most frequent issues and how to prevent them. Firstly, poor navigation can frustrate visitors ; ensure your platform is simple to navigate with a logical hierarchy. Secondly, neglecting adaptability for mobile devices is a serious error; your website *must* look great on all devices. Thirdly, sluggish speeds can discourage potential clients ; reduce images and leverage caching. Finally, ignoring usability for users with limitations is unacceptable ; follow accessibility guidelines .
- Poor Navigation: Create a clear menu structure .
- Lack of Responsiveness: Use a mobile-friendly approach .
- Slow Loading Speeds: Compress media and leverage caching.
- Ignoring Accessibility: Follow web accessibility standards .
